From 6c4d9d96aa03c20877506391a648b727f21708a3 Mon Sep 17 00:00:00 2001 From: Oswald Auguste de Bruin Date: Tue, 6 Aug 2013 13:35:19 +0200 Subject: [PATCH] Ogg Really working --- lib/ogg.cpp |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/lib/ogg.cpp b/lib/ogg.cpp index 4c9bbba8..52a112e1 100644 --- a/lib/ogg.cpp +++ b/lib/ogg.cpp @@ -128,8 +128,7 @@ namespace OGG{ void Page::setGranulePosition(long long unsigned int newVal){ if(checkDataSize(14)){ - ((long unsigned*)(data+6))[1] = htonl(newVal & 0xFFFFFFFF); - ((long unsigned*)(data+6))[0] = htonl((newVal >> 32) & 0xFFFFFFFF); + set_64(data+6, newVal); } } @@ -202,7 +201,6 @@ namespace OGG{ for (unsigned int i = 0; i < layout.size(); i++){ dataSum += layout[i]; } - std::cerr << "dataSum size: " << dataSum << std::endl; unsigned int place = 0; char table[255]; for (unsigned int i = 0; i < layout.size(); i++){ @@ -456,7 +454,6 @@ namespace OGG{ if(!checkDataSize(27 + getPageSegments() + length)){//check if size available in memory return false; } - std::cerr << "Payload length: " << length << std::endl; memcpy(data + 27 + getPageSegments(), newData, length); return true; }